Measured by revenue, the Big 4 global bookkeeping firms consist of Deloitte, Ernst & Youthful (EY), PricewaterhouseCoopers (PwC), and Klynveld Peat Marwick Goerdeler (KPMG). All 4 are leading resources of tax obligation law analysis and audit and bookkeeping criteria.


Some Known Factual Statements About Succentrix Business Advisors


The Big Four supply auditing, tax obligation, consulting, assessment, market research, assurance, and legal advising services. The biggest of the Big 4, Deloitte's workforce expanded to over 457,000 staff members during their 2023 financial year.


PwC also added 36,000 even more jobs during the year, boosting its workforce to even more than 364,000 in 152 countries. The company made a $3.7 billion investment in skill and business purchases to expand its expertise in cloud and innovation consulting and range its expert system capacities. For FY 2023, Ernst & Young reported approximately $49.9 billion of company-wide earnings.


The company operates in 150 nations. 2023 Annual Revenue in U.S. Dollars # of Staff Members # of Nations of Operation/Headquarters Deloitte $64.9 billion 457,000 150/London, UK PwC $53.1 billion 364,000 152/New York City, U.S


The initial 8, based in the United state or the U. https://succentrix.blog.ss-blog.jp/2024-07-17?1721183473.K., included Arthur Andersen, Arthur Young, Coopers & Lybrand, Deloitte Haskin & Sells, Ernst & Whinney, Peat Marwick Mitchell, Price Waterhouse, and Touche Ross.


The Big 4 executes a lot of the auditing benefit a few of the largest public firms. In 2022, the Big Four constituted 99.7% of the S&P 500 market, controling the audit cost market share. PwC led with 35.7%, according to data put together by Ideagen. In 2002, "Huge Eight" company Arthur Andersen was found to have shredded documentation in an initiative to conceal Enron's falsified financial numbers.

Each firm likewise helps with mergers, acquisitions, corporate restructurings, and forensic accountancy.


Big Four employees usually work long hours throughout the active period, sometimes doubling the hours worked throughout the off-season. The active period typically begins at the beginning of the schedule year with tax obligation records and returns due in between January and April. Big 4 firms are likewise hectic during periods when companies report quarterly or yearly incomes.
